LAG Gaming enters this ESL Challenger League Season 51 North America Cup #3 lower bracket matchup as the higher-ranked squad at #87 HLTV, boasting a 73% win rate over the last three months and a four-match streak including 2-1 over BOSS and 2-0 over Pulse after an upper bracket forfeit loss to InControl. Zomblers, ranked #193 with a 52% recent win rate, advanced via 2-1 over Pulse and 2-0 over Reign Above before a 1-2 upper bracket exit against regain, amid roster tweaks adding FxRE and HAMBOOGA late March. LAG holds a 2-0 head-to-head edge from February's CCT Series 3 (Dust2 13-8, Inferno 13-7), underscoring stylistic edges in BO3 playoffs where double-elimination demands consistency amid CS2's evolving meta.

This market will resolve to "Zomblers" if Zomblers win the match against LAG Gaming.
This market will resolve to "LAG Gaming" if LAG Gaming win the match against Zomblers.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one team wins due to the opponent's forfeiture, disqualification, or walkover, this market will resolve to the team who wins.
If the match ends in a forfeit, disqualification, or walkover (team withdraws before the start and the other wins autom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The resolution source for this market will be official information from https://hltv.org. However, if https://hltv.org has not published final results within 2 hours after the event’s con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ead including video evidence.
In cases where a team’s listed name includes minor discrepancies from the resolution source, this market will resolve based on the underlying real-world match rather than exact name matching. Recognizable abbreviations, alternate or erroneous spellings, sponsor tags, affiliate or academy designations, regional identifiers, and minor formatting differences will be treated as referring to the same team, provided the intended team can be clearly and uniquely identified within the relevant competition. If a listed team name has no reasonable connection to any participating team, or if it matches or could reasonably refer to another team in the same competition such that the intended team cannot be unambiguously determined, this market will resolve 50-50.
